Kevin De Bruyne: A Premier League Legend Ready to Leave Manchester City
Pep Guardiola has hailed Kevin De Bruyne as one of the greatest players ever in the Premier League. This comes after the Belgian announced that he will be leaving Manchester City at the end of the season. De Bruyne, 33, has been a key player in Manchester Cityโs rise as the dominant team in English football since joining from Wolfsburg for ยฃ55 million in 2015.
De Bruyneโs Impact at Manchester City
Since his arrival at the Etihad, De Bruyne has won 14 major trophies, including six Premier League titles and the 2023 Champions League. He has also scored 106 goals and provided 174 assists in 413 appearances for the club. His contributions have been crucial to Cityโs success, making him one of the most influential players in the club’s history.
Pep Guardiola, the manager of Manchester City, spoke highly of De Bruyneโs achievements. “He is one of the greatest midfielders ever to play in this country and for this club โ there is no doubt,” Guardiola said. “We’ve won a lot of trophies and he’s been involved in every single one.”
The Challenges of Recent Seasons
Despite De Bruyneโs incredible record, his influence has been affected in recent seasons due to injury problems. Last year, he missed five months due to a hamstring tear and has struggled to maintain a consistent presence on the pitch this season. He has started just 21 of Cityโs 47 matches across all competitions.
Guardiola acknowledged these challenges but praised De Bruyne’s consistency during his peak years. “For his consistency, except the last year, year-and-a-half, due to injury problems, heโs been there every time,” he said. “His assists, goals, and vision in the final third are so difficult to replace.”
The Legacy of De Bruyne
Guardiola also highlighted the rarity of De Bruyneโs skills. “Everyone can make actions for assists, but how many years and games he has been doing it makes him unique.” De Bruyneโs legacy at City will likely be remembered alongside other greats, such as Vincent Kompany, David Silva, and Sergio Aguero, who all have statues outside the Etihad Stadium.
“I would bet a lot of money that it is going to happen, that’s for sure,” Guardiola said when asked about a statue for De Bruyne. “He deserves to be in this level.”
Whatโs Next for Kevin De Bruyne?
It is still unclear whether De Bruyne will leave Manchester City at the end of the Premier League season or if he will stay until the Club World Cup, which runs from June 14 to July 13. His contract is set to expire in June, and Guardiola said that De Bruyne has to decide what he wants to do next.
โItโs a good question I donโt know,โ Guardiola said. โHe has to decide, itโs a new competition. I hope he can continue to play football in another place, but it depends on risk and contracts for the future.โ
